
Express Receiver Gets NFL Shot
April 25, 2012 - Indoor Football League (IFL)
Reading Express News Release
Current Express wide receiver and former Shepherd University standout Dominique Jones has been a household name so far this season. While leading the team in receiving and making spectacular grabs, Jones has caught the eye of the NFL's Indianapolis Colts.
Jones left Tuesday night for Indianapolis where he will get a chance to try out and make the Colts roster.
Jones uses his combination of height and strength along with his reliable hands to snatch footballs away from defenders. Through seven games with the Express, he leads the team with 39 receptions and 349 receiving yards. Holding a spot as a top 10 receiver in the IFL this season, Jones has hauled in seven touchdowns.
During his senior year at Shepherd University, Jones racked up 34 receptions for a total of 403 yards and nine touchdowns. He also helped Shepherd advance to the Division II National Semi-Finals and a school record 12 wins. Jones was a third team All-American selection and a second team All-Conference selection as a senior.
Prior to playing with the Express, Jones gained professional football experience as a tight end for the UFL's Sacramento Mountain Lions.
